True Brews: The art of craft beers

The beer renaissance in the US since the mid-'80s is a phenomenal crowd (enthusiasm) funding project. It has caused brewmasters to dredge up - among other varieties - a memory of India Pale Ale (IPA) and reintroduce it to bitter-loving beerheads. The IPA was born of desperate British attempts to produce a beer that could withstand the vagaries of time and a sea journey from London to its colony in India. Grand Rapids in the state of Michigan have earned it the title of ‘Beer City’ because of its vibrant craft beer industry that produces small and balanced batches. Along the city’s Beer City Ale Trail there are 60 breweries, while the local calendar is filled with beer festivals, events and promotions. You can take a pick from among the Great Lakes Pub Cruiser, the Grand Rapids Motor City Brew Tour from Detroit, or a GR Hopper Pass.
